ラベルをクリックしたときにInfoTipを作成して表示する方法 -- winforms フィールド と visual-studio フィールド と popup フィールド と visual-studio-2012 フィールド と tooltip フィールド 関連 問題

How to create and show a infotip when clickng a label?












0
vote

問題

日本語

私はvstudio2012を使っています、私の問題は単純そうだが私には難しすぎる、

edit :それは「Windows Formsアプリケーション」

です。

ラベルを持っていて、私がラベルをクリックすると、「InfoTip」または「Tooltip」または「BlayOntip」に小さな情報を表示したい場合は、5~10秒のようなメッセージを表示したいです。

誰かがこれを作る方法について私を導くことができますか?またはWeb上の参考文献をお願いします。

edit2 :私はこれを試しました:

<事前> <コード> Private Sub Label1_Click(sender As Object, e As EventArgs) Handles Label1.Click 'MessageBox.Show("Use the 'Ctrl+C' hotkey to copy the" & vbNewLine & "mouse coordinates into the clipboard.", "Mouse XY by Elektro H@cker") End Sub Private Sub ToolTip1_Popup(sender As Object, e As PopupEventArgs) Handles ToolTip1.Popup ToolTip1.Show("Tooltip text goes here", Label1) End Sub
英語

I'm using VSTUDIO2012, my problem seems simple but it's too hard for me,

EDIT: It's a "windows forms application"

I have a label and when i click at the label i want to show a little info in a "infotip" or "tooltip" or "ballontip", i want to show a message like for 5-10 seconds...

Someone can guide me about how to make this? or references on the web please?

EDIT2: I've tried this:

Private Sub Label1_Click(sender As Object, e As EventArgs) Handles Label1.Click      'MessageBox.Show("Use the 'Ctrl+C' hotkey to copy the" & vbNewLine & "mouse coordinates into the clipboard.", "Mouse XY by Elektro H@cker") End Sub  Private Sub ToolTip1_Popup(sender As Object, e As PopupEventArgs) Handles ToolTip1.Popup     ToolTip1.Show("Tooltip text goes here", Label1) End Sub 
</div
              
         
         

回答リスト

1
 
vote
vote
ベストアンサー
 

アプリケーションを起動するときは、画面の中央に作業しているフォームが作業してください。

画面の左側には、「ツールボックス」と表示されたパネルが表示されます(パネルの手配方法によっては、画面の様々な側面にある可能性があります。デフォルトが残っていると思います。見えない場合それは、[表示]メニューから[ツールボックス]を選択するか、[Ctrl + Alt + X "を押して表示できます。)

「ツールボックス」パネルを開くと、いくつかの折りたたみパネルが表示されます。 「すべてのWindowsフォーム」または「共通コントロール」を開きます。各折りたたみ領域の下部付近の要素は、ラベル付きの 'Tooltip'を追加できる要素です。それが正常に追加されたら、淡い灰色のコントロールパネルが新しいツールチップコントロールとラベル付けされた「Tooltip1」と表示されます。

コントロールを追加したら、ラベルなどのツールチップを追加する要素を右クリックします。ポップアップコンテキストメニューが表示されたら、[プロパティ](最後のオプション)を選択します。これにより、プロパティパネルが開きます。

プロパティパネルが開いたら、リストの下部までスクロールします。 TextAlignプロパティの直下は、ToolTip1のToolTipというプロパティです。ここにツールチップテキストを入力してください。ユーザーがラベルの上をホバーしたときに、入力されたテキストは標準の黄色がかったポップアップツールチップに表示されます。

 

When you start your application, you should your form you're working on in the center of the screen.

On the left side of the screen you should see a panel labeled 'Toolbox' (it may be on different sides of the screen depending on how you arrange your panels. I think default is left though. If you don't see it you can show it by selecting 'Toolbox' from the view menu or by pressing "Ctrl + Alt + X".).

With the 'Toolbox' panel open, you should see several collapsible panels. Open either 'All Windows Forms' or 'Common Controls'. Near the bottom of each collapsible area is an element you can add labeled 'ToolTip'. Once its been added successfully, a light gray control panel appears with your new ToolTip control labeled 'ToolTip1'.

Once the control is added you simply right click on an element that you want to add a tooltip to such as a label. When the popup context menu appears choose 'Properties' (the very last option). This opens the Properties Panel.

When the Properties Panel opens, scroll to the bottom of the list. Right below the TextAlign Property should be a property called ToolTip on ToolTip1. Enter your tooltip text here. Now when a user hovers over your label, the text entered will appear in a standard yellowish popup tooltip.

</div
 
 
     
     

関連する質問

0  ラベルをクリックしたときにInfoTipを作成して表示する方法  ( How to create and show a infotip when clickng a label ) 
私はvstudio2012を使っています、私の問題は単純そうだが私には難しすぎる、 edit :それは「Windows Formsアプリケーション」です。 ラベルを持っていて、私がラベルをクリックすると、「InfoTip」または「Tooltip」または「B...

0  Flexiridテーブル:テーブルセルデータにツールチップを追加する方法  ( Flexigrid table how to add tooltip in table cell data ) 
テーブルヘッダにツールチップを与えました。 required=""1 を追加することによって COLモデルの繰り返しの下のFlexGrid.jsファイルで <事前> <コード> required=""2 のように使う: <事前> <コード> require...

19  テキストのマウスホバーにツールチップを表示する  ( Displaying tooltip on mouse hover of a text ) 
カスタムリッチ編集コントロールのリンクの上にマウスがホバリングしたときにツールチップを表示したいです。次のテキストを考慮してください。 私たち全員睡眠夜に 私の場合の sleep はリンクです。 リンクの下のマウスを移動すると、この場合は「スリープ」、...

40  NVD3 Piechart.js - ツールチップの編集方法  ( Nvd3 piechart js how to edit the tooltip ) 
私はNVD3のpiechart.jsコンポーネントを使用してサイトにPieChartを生成しています。提供された.jsファイルには、次のようにいくつかのVARが含まれています。 <事前> <コード> var margin = {top: 30, right: ...

2  SELECTがクリックされた場合、JQuery UIツールチップが閉じます  ( Jquery ui tooltip closes if select gets clicked ) 
jQuery UIツールチップを持っていて、ツールチップの選択をクリックするたびにツールチップが閉じます。 これはこれに関連しています。 MouseEnter MouseLeaveとSelect これは機能しません。 <コード> $(".select_t...

1  ChartJS ToolTipにさらにデータ要素を追加する  ( Adding more data elements to chartjs tooltip ) 
Chaltjsを使ってドーナツチャートを作り、ツールチップに追加の要素を追加する方法について興味があります。私のコードは以下の通りです: <事前> <コード> export const validationSchema = object().shape({ ...

0  ツールチップとしてのWPFコンボボックス画像  ( Wpf combo box image as tooltip ) 
コンボボックスを含むWPFアプリケーションを作成しています。コンボボックスにマウスがあるときは、コンボが弦のアップルとオレンジ色を含むとします。対応する画像をツールチップとして表示する必要があります。 次のリンクからサンプルアプリケーションを取得しました。 ...

0  UltraTooltipは最初のMouseHoverでロードされていません  ( Ultratooltip not loading in first mousehover ) 
私は私のWinFormsアプリケーションでInfragistics NetAdvantage 2010を使用しています。これは、ボタンのマウスハーバーにカスタムツールチップをロードするためのコードです。 <事前> <コード> private void butt...

4  さまざまな種類のjQuery Tooltip個別遅延  ( Jquery tooltip individual delay for different types ) 
jQuery-UIからツールチップを見たばかりで、次のコードがオンになっている: <事前> <コード> $(function() { $( document ).tooltip({ items: "[tooltip],...

1  Google+のもののようなツールチップを作成する方法は?  ( How can i create a tooltip like the ones in google ) 
Google+のような機能を作成しようとしています。ユーザーがウィンドウのサイズを変更した場合、左側のメニュー項目は隠されていて、ユーザーが表示されたメニュー項目がToolTipに表示され始めているときに表示されます。上の画像。 私は中途半端です。ウィ...




© 2022 cndgn.com All Rights Reserved. Q&Aハウス 全著作権所有